Notes

Olimar's Notes

Bodily excretions of a highly flammable waxy substance interact with the cell structure of this grub-dog's skin, causing a chemical reaction that produces extremely high temperatures. The skin benefits from a spongy cell structure that diffuses surface heat, protecting the creature's inner organs. Due to the astonishing amount of heat produced by this beast, it should be observed with great caution.

Louie's Notes

No stove? No problem! This sizzling beast practically cooks itself. Remember to thoroughly extinguish the steaks prior to eating.

Only the appearance and notes have changed. The right eyeball is now the same size as the left one.

Olimar's Notes

This dangerous creature secretes a substance that causes a chemical reaction with its epidermis, causing a flame that envelops the beast. It is also worthwhile to note that its right eyeball is significantly larger than in the past. When it was still small, there were no lens, causing that eye to not be able to see. As such, this heavily impacted the fiery bulblax's vision, as most grub-dogs have been observed to heavily rely on vision to hunt prey. This caused most fiery bulblaxes to disappear, except for the fortuitous ones whose right eyes were normal sized. As such, they survived and reproduced, and passed on their genes, making most fiery bulblaxes to have a pair of fully functioning eyeballs.
